Dunno if this is going to get moved but I'm going to start breaking my granada cossie as I'm using the engine,loom,ecu,brakes in my saff but want to know are there certain things that I need to keep for the conversion

Diff is LSD.
Rear discs should be vented (albeit 5 stud) Which is a pair of good calipers.
Should have a rear roll bar.
Keep the Master Cylinder/servo & valve block.
Try to get the ABS wires out of the hubs - can be worth a few quid, in fact keep the whole loom.
???Electric sunroof should be worth keeping all the gubbings for selling on.
Keep the clocks for the rev counter - if you use it or not - can be sold to thjose who will use it.
